How they compare
Guatemala currently reports 23.9% against 23.0% in Zambia, a difference of 0.9%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Zambia ahead.
Guatemala ranks 26th and Zambia ranks 28th of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Guatemala averaged higher in 1 and Zambia in 5.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Guatemala | Zambia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 9.8% | 19.7% | 9.9% | Zambia |
| 1970s | 4.1% | 26.0% | 21.9% | Zambia |
| 1980s | 22.5% | 26.0% | 3.5% | Zambia |
| 1990s | 25.0% | 29.2% | 4.2% | Zambia |
| 2000s | 26.0% | 37.0% | 11.0% | Zambia |
| 2010s | 23.9% | 23.0% | 0.9% | Guatemala |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
